The Ultimate Guide to the BMW i3 Charging Port: Tips, Troubleshooting, and More

The BMW i3 charging port is the dedicated entry point for replenishing the high-voltage battery pack in BMW's pioneering electric mobility solution. Located on the driver's side flank of the vehicle, this interface is engineered for efficiency and safety, allowing the i3 to accept either alternating current (AC) from standard wall boxes or public pedestals, or direct current (DC) from rapid charging infrastructure. Understanding the specifications, functionality, and best practices for this port is essential for current and prospective i3 owners to maximize convenience and battery longevity.

Physical Design and Location

Physically, the BMW i3 charging port is a slim, rectangular shroud positioned just ahead of the rear wheel on the driver's side. It is protected by a flush-fitting, spring-loaded door that aligns seamlessly with the car's aerodynamic body, minimizing visual clutter and preserving the clean, futuristic design language. The port itself features a standardized inlet that accepts a Combined Charging System (CCS) connector for DC fast charging or a Type 2 inlet for AC charging, depending on the specific market configuration and model year. This placement ensures the charging cable exits the vehicle at a height that is convenient for plugging into most public or home chargers without requiring excessive bending or reaching.

AC vs. DC Charging Capabilities

The functionality of the BMW i3 charging port is defined by its ability to handle both AC and DC currents. For daily use, the port accepts AC charging via a Type 2 connector in Europe or a J1772 connector in North America, typically from home wall boxes or public AC pedestals. This alternating current is converted to direct current by the onboard charger located within the vehicle. For rapid replenishment at public stations, the port integrates a CCS (Combined Charging System) inlet, which allows for direct current input, bypassing the onboard charger to significantly reduce charging times. This dual capability makes the i3 versatile for a wide range of charging environments, from overnight top-ups at home to quick boosts on long-distance trips.

Charging Speeds and Power Limits

When discussing the BMW i3 charging port, it is critical to understand the associated power limits and resulting charging speeds. For AC charging, the onboard charger typically handles up to 11 kW or, in some later models, an optional 12 kW, translating to roughly 40 to 50 miles of range per hour of charging. For DC fast charging, the port supports rates of up to 50 kW or, with a specific optional upgrade, 100 kW, enabling the battery to reach approximately 80% in 30 to 40 minutes under optimal conditions. These figures are heavily dependent on the specific power output of the charging station, the vehicle's software settings, and the state of the battery.

Operational Protocols and Security

Operationally, the BMW i3 charging port communicates with the charging station using standardized protocols such as OCPP (Open Charge Point Protocol) for public charging or BMW's own charging communication standards. The process is typically initiated by the driver via the BMW ConnectedDrive app, the vehicle's iDrive system, or a card reader on the charger itself, which authorizes the session. The port and inlet are designed with safety interlocks that prevent disconnection under load, and the charging cable's connector securely latches into place, ensuring a stable and safe electrical connection throughout the charging cycle.

Maintenance, Care, and Troubleshooting

Maintaining the BMW i3 charging port requires minimal effort but ensures long-term reliability. Owners should regularly inspect the port door and surrounding area for debris, dirt, or physical damage that could impede the charging connector's proper seating. It is advisable to avoid using excessive force when plugging or unplugging the cable and to keep the contacts clean and dry. If the port fails to communicate with a charger, common troubleshooting steps include checking the vehicle's charge port lock settings in the iDrive menu, resetting the vehicle's electronics, or consulting a BMW dealer to diagnose potential issues with the onboard charger or high-voltage wiring.
